How long does a brake replacement take?

  • Brake pad replacement typically takes about 1 to 2 hours, depending on axle and any required additional work.
  • Rotor replacement or machining usually takes longer—often 2 to 3 hours for a complete axle—or longer if both axles are serviced the same day.

How often should you replace the brake pads and rotors?

  • Brake pad life depends on driving style and conditions—many drivers expect 30,000 to 70,000 miles. Rotors typically last longer but should be inspected each pad change.
  • Routine inspections at recommended intervals help catch uneven wear early and keep replacement costs lower over time.
  • Our technicians perform full inspections and will advise whether pads, rotors, or both need service—doing both when needed avoids premature rework.

2015 Toyota Avalon Brake Pads and Rotors

Replacing brake pads without evaluating the rotors can lead to reduced stopping performance and premature wear, which is why our team at Nalley Toyota Union City inspects both components together. When pads are worn and rotors are scored or warped, installing new pads on old rotors may cause vibration, noise, and uneven wear that costs you more over time. Our technicians measure rotor thickness and runout, check caliper operation, and evaluate pad compound suitability for your driving habits. If rotors need resurfacing or replacement, we explain the long-term benefits: consistent contact surface, improved heat dissipation, and smoother pedal feel.
